Buster.so - Short Review

Analytics Tools



Buster.so Overview

Buster.so is an innovative, AI-powered tool designed to revolutionize the way organizations interact with and analyze their data. Here’s a detailed look at what Buster.so does and its key features:



Core Functionality

Buster.so allows users to embed a robust data experience directly into web applications. It enables users to query their data using plain English, facilitating an interactive and self-service model for data analytics. This tool is particularly useful for creating dashboards, visualizing insights, and building customized data models.



Key Features



Natural Language Queries

Users can ask text-based questions about their data, and Buster.so delivers swift answers, enhancing the data exploration process.



Integration and Connectivity

Buster.so seamlessly integrates with all major databases and data warehouses. It can connect to these systems easily and train a model on the database, making it production-ready within a day.



No-Code Builder

The tool includes a no-code builder that allows users to customize user interface elements such as components, colors, fonts, and charts. This feature makes it accessible to a wide range of users, regardless of their technical expertise.



AI-Powered Reporting and Visualization

Buster.so eases the implementation of AI-powered reporting features into web applications. Users can generate robust visualizations and build their own dashboards on the fly.



Data Warehouse Management

Buster.so can deploy and fully manage a data warehouse on behalf of the user. It uses a headless, open-source, high-performance OLAP data warehouse powered by Apache Iceberg, StarRocks, and S3. This setup is significantly cheaper and faster than traditional solutions like Snowflake. It also optimizes the data warehouse by identifying common query patterns and auto-partitioning data for faster query times.



ETL Pipelines and Data Unification

Buster.so manages pre-built ETL pipelines powered by Airbyte and allows the creation of custom ETL pipelines on demand using dltHub. It unifies data into a single schema and integrates new schemas into existing data models, enabling real-time data ingestion pipelines via API.



Data Modeling

The tool rapidly builds analytics-ready data models, integrating all company data into a single, shared data model. It functions as a modeling copilot, aware of the data structures and capable of building robust datasets. Buster.so also integrates seamlessly with dbt, syncing model and metadata changes automatically.



AI Safety and Guardrails

Buster.so implements strict guardrails around AI querying capabilities, ensuring that queries stay within the bounds of the defined data models. It flags queries that make assumptions not explicitly defined in the data model and allows for automated actions such as notifying users, blocking queries, or generating pull requests for model improvements.



Auto-Documentation and Learning

The tool generates and auto-updates documentation on business terminology, data structures, and company goals. This documentation serves as a context and memory layer for the AI, enabling it to build a deeper understanding of the business and data stack over time.



Code-Based and Git-Native

Everything in Buster.so is managed as code, living in the user’s own GitHub repository. This allows for version control, support for multiple environments, bulk updates, and integration with CI/CD pipelines and other tools like dbt.



Open Source

Buster.so is fully open source, deployable in any cloud environment, ensuring no vendor lock-in and complete control over the deployment.

In summary, Buster.so is a powerful AI-driven tool that simplifies data analytics, enhances data visualization, and optimizes data management through its intuitive interface, robust integration capabilities, and continuous learning features.

Scroll to Top